-/**
- * Handler class providing Socket functionality to OIO client application. By using VirtualSocket user can
- * use OIO application in asynchronous environment and NIO EventLoop. Using VirtualSocket OIO applications
- * are able to use full potential of NIO environment.
- */
-public class VirtualSocket extends Socket implements ChannelHandler {
- private static final String INPUT_STREAM = "inputStream";
- private static final String OUTPUT_STREAM = "outputStream";
-
- private final ChannelInputStream chis = new ChannelInputStream();
- private final ChannelOutputStream chos = new ChannelOutputStream();
- private ChannelHandlerContext ctx;
-
-
- public InputStream getInputStream() {
- return this.chis;
- }
-
- public OutputStream getOutputStream() {
- return this.chos;
- }
-
- public void handlerAdded(ChannelHandlerContext ctx) {
- this.ctx = ctx;
-
- if (ctx.channel().pipeline().get(OUTPUT_STREAM) == null) {
- ctx.channel().pipeline().addFirst(OUTPUT_STREAM, chos);
- }
-
- if (ctx.channel().pipeline().get(INPUT_STREAM) == null) {
- ctx.channel().pipeline().addFirst(INPUT_STREAM, chis);
- }
- }
-
- public void handlerRemoved(ChannelHandlerContext ctx) {
- if (ctx.channel().pipeline().get(OUTPUT_STREAM) != null) {
- ctx.channel().pipeline().remove(OUTPUT_STREAM);
- }
-
- if (ctx.channel().pipeline().get(INPUT_STREAM) != null) {
- ctx.channel().pipeline().remove(INPUT_STREAM);
- }
- }
-
- public void exceptionCaught(ChannelHandlerContext ctx, Throwable throwable) {
- // TODO exceptionCaught is deprecated transform this handler
- ctx.fireExceptionCaught(throwable);
- }
